#001-Welcome to the first short-but-sweet episode of Autobiology Bits! In this episode, you will be introduced to your biology maven, JLF, and what it takes to become an autobiologist. Hint: you probably already are! JLF also introduces the first autobiology bit about a fun topic that helps you realize how the brain can process sounds differently, resulting in various emotional responses, depending on how you are wired. Episode #002 - In this episode, we'll talk about the mechanics of tattoos, and a surprising discovery made just in the last couple of years about WHY they are so hard to remove. You'll also get to hear about the year I turned 18, which means I'm...oh heck I"ll do the math for you! 45 in 2020.
